3I second this Radio Shack emotion. I actually have both this digital model and the old VU meter one--having the needle is good for average level, but the digital catches transients better and will log max and min and whatnot. I use mine in live situations generally, though, being a FOH guy. There are better meters for more critical situations, but if you're just wanting to check how long you can stand the current level before real damage happens or trying to stay out of trouble with the fuzz, this one will do it, and at a fraction of the price.
